Well, the simple answer would be to just 'Cntrl+P' the whole thing. But I saw that half of the page width is not printed upon. You can try to print in landscape, but it's still the same.
What you can do is, go tho this website.
It does what it says, i.e. 'Make any web page print friendly'
So you go to the page, enter the url, and click 'print preview'
You'll get the print preview which makes it a better printable document. No sidebar, content in the proper format etc. You can even remove things that you don't want from the page preview. You get link to print the page, or directly download the pdf.

I realize that in internet days, this post is ancient, but in case anyone is still interested, here's the JavaScript for a bookmarklet that will immediately open the page you're on at printfriendly.com:
javascript:(function() { open('http://www.printfriendly.com/print/?url=' + document.URL).focus(); })();
Just copy and paste the above code into the URL field for a bookmark and off you go!

Well, your posts are HTML so you can just copy that from the built-in editor — the same you use to write your posts.
But for the future you might want to consider writing posts in Markdown and then converting that to HTML before you upload them into Wordpress. (Or use a plugin which accepts Markdown, that's best IMO.) This way you can keep a cleanly formatted post in your Dropbox or where ever ;)
